1. Based on my observations, Potash characteristics and transport risks
The main component of potassium fertilizer is potassium salt, and common potassium fertilizers include potassium chloride and potassium sulfate. Makes sense, right?. They generally exist in the form of granules or powder. while potassium fertilizer itself is non-flammable, there are still certain risks during transportation. But to instance, wet conditions might result in moisture-absorbing and caking of potash fertilizer, which might affect transportation efficiency; if overuse potash fertilizer is leaked, it might result in contamination to soil systems and aquatic environments sources. And Therefore, it's particularly crucial to understand the environment of potash fertilizer and take efficiently measures to prevent possible risks in transportation.
2. Packaging and storage: moisture-proof leakage is the key
correct packaging and storage conditions are critical to ensure that potash fertilizer isn't exposed to moisture, contamination or leakage during transport. The packaging of potash fertilizer should choose strong and durable materials, such as plastic bags, woven bags or plastic drums. From what I've seen, These packaging is able to efficiently prevent moisture and ensure that the potash fertilizer won't seepage during transportation. Potash fertilizers should be stored in a dry, well-ventilated ecological stability, avoiding direct exposure to rain or moisture. In the process of storage, it should be ensured that the goods aren't affected by high temperature or severe collision, so as to minimize harm and loss. But
3. In my experience, Transport selection and security measures
The choice of transportation tools immediately affects the security of potash fertilizer transportation. According to the packaging form and transportation distance of potash fertilizer, it's very crucial to choose the appropriate transportation mode. But Based on my observations, to bulk potash, you is able to choose container transport, bulk carrier or special truck. Transport vehicles should be equipped with appropriate moisture-proof facilities, such as waterproof is able tovas cover, to prevent moisture intrusion caused by heavy rain weather. But Transport vehicles also need to be inspected regularly to ensure that their mechanical performance is healthy, especially in terms of brake systems, tires, and cargo compartment seals. Transportation personnel must be professionally trained to understand the security standards to potash transportation, including how to deal with emergencies, such as spills or other dangerous situations during transportation.
